Today on the show we’ll be talking with Maureen Kerrigan from RBC Wealth Management, Financial Advisers and Courtney Chellgren of the Kerrigan Chellgren Investment Group. This mother daughter team will be discussing the idea that you don’t have to be a Gates or a Buffet for your gift to make a difference, the importance of the Charitable giving and how philanthropy fits in your life and estate planning. They will also be discussing RBC’s Blue Water Project, a 10-year global charitable commitment of $50 million to help provide access to drinkable, swimmable, fishable water, now and for future generations. .

In the second half of the show we will be talking all about the PVD Fringe Festival produced  by one of our local theater companies, The Wilbury Theatre Group. Joining us will be the Executive Director of the Wilbury Group Josh Short and performer and comedian Stuart Wilson who will be performing this week at the Fringe Festival.
